65340 Missouri Public Schools
- For the 2021 school year, there are 10 public schools in 65340, Missouri, serving 2,479 students.
- Public schools in zipcode 65340 have an average math proficiency score of 28% (versus the Missouri public school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 33% (versus the 49% statewide average). Schools in 65340, Missouri have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Missouri public schools.
- The top ranked public schools in 65340, Missouri are Hardeman Elementary School, Marshall Senior High School and Northwest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
- Minority enrollment is 39%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Missouri public school average of 29% (majority Black).
- The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is equal to the Missouri public school average of 14:1.
